Lot 126. A small blue and white shallow bowl, 17th century; 4 1⁄4 in. (10.6 cm.) diam. Estimate USD 1,500 - USD 2,500. Price Realised USD 1,750. © Christie's Images Ltd 2020
The interior of the bowl is decorated with fish leaping amidst aquatic plants around the slightly domed center, the exterior with blossoming branches extending from the double lines below the mouth rim. The base has an apocryphal Jiajing mark.
Property from the Collection of Peter Tcherepnine.
